Description

Sedge. In spring the new leaves emerge whiter than white, gradually acquiring their thin green margins which deepen with age. Showy flowers of red-brown and jet black. Best in a container. Max Height 60cm. Flowers April to June. Full sun/partial shade. Hardy. Water thoroughly before planting.
